Historical & Cultural Background

The name Benni is often considered a diminutive or variant of the name Benjamin, which has its roots in the Hebrew language. The Hebrew name Binyamin translates to 'son of the right hand' or 'favored son.' This name appears in the Hebrew Bible, where Benjamin is the youngest son of Jacob and Rachel, a significant figure in the biblical narrative.

The name was later adopted into Greek as Beniamin and subsequently into Latin as Benjamin, before making its way into Old French, where it was further adapted. The transition into English occurred during the Middle Ages, with the name becoming more widely recognized through biblical translations and religious texts, including the King James Bible published in 1611, which helped solidify its presence in English-speaking cultures.

Throughout history, the name Benjamin has been borne by various notable figures, including several saints and historical leaders. In the Christian tradition, Saint Benjamin is recognized as a martyr, and his feast day is celebrated on January 31.

The name has also been associated with various Jewish historical figures and scholars, contributing to its cultural resonance within Jewish communities. The use of diminutives like Benni reflects a common linguistic practice of creating affectionate or informal versions of names, which can enhance their personal significance.

Benni McCarthy is a former professional footballer best known for playing with Ajax, Porto, and the South African national team.
